TIMOTHY FOSU-MENSAH became the latest Manchester United player to be sidelined with injury after hurting his shoulder during the 0-0 draw with Manchester City.
Timothy Fosu-Mensah is the latest Manchester United player to be sidelined through injury
The Dutch defender was brought on as an 86th-minute substitute following Marouane Fellaini's red card, but suffered a shoulder injury during the last action of the 0-0 draw.
Fosu-Mensah posted a picture of himself on a treatment table with his right arm in a sling following the match, adding to Jose Mourinho's injury woes ahead of Sunday's clash with Swansea City (12pm).
Manchester United are already without Chris Smalling, Phil Jones, Paul Pogba, Marcos Rojo and Zlatan Ibrahimovic due to injury, while Fellaini will serve a two-match suspension.
